Step 1: Build a Quarterly Update Cycle

The biggest mistake is updating only when rankings drop.

Instead, use a proactive cycle.

Recommended cadence:

  • monthly CTR checks
  • quarterly content refresh
  • semiannual link audit
  • annual pillar expansion

Mini Example:

An authority blog refreshed 12 comparison pages every 90 days.

After 2 quarters:

  • recovered lost rankings
  • organic clicks +18%
  • affiliate revenue stabilized

Small updates compound.

Step 2: Refresh High-Intent Sections First

Not every section needs equal attention.

Prioritize:

  • pricing sections
  • comparison tables
  • alternatives
  • pros vs cons
  • verdict boxes

These sections influence clicks most.

Step 3: Update Based on Search Intent Drift

This is the expert layer most competitors miss.

Sometimes rankings drop because search intent evolves.

Example:

2025 intent = features
2026 intent = ROI + workflow use case

The content must evolve with the query.

Mini realistic case:

A page updated its structure from features-first to ROI-first.

Result:

  • CTR +10%
  • average position improved

This is intent maintenance.

Step 4: Strengthen Internal Link Freshness

Every update cycle should also refresh links.

Add:

  • new support articles
  • updated comparisons
  • fresh pillar references
  • new monetization pages

This keeps the cluster semantically alive.

Advanced Expert Insight

Contrarian truth:

Sometimes updating less content more deeply beats updating everything lightly.

Focus on pages already receiving impressions and clicks.

This often delivers stronger ROI than mass refreshes.

FAQ

How often should affiliate articles be updated?
Every 90 days for high-intent pages is a strong standard.

What sections matter most?
Pricing, verdicts, and comparisons.

Does freshness help SEO?
Yes, especially for commercial keywords.
